THIRTEEN RIDDIM produced by 10 FLOOR RECORDS 2011
Thirteen Overview
The Thirteen Riddim sound system cut became a true favorite in 2011 dancehall. This version stood out from other mixes of the time because of its powerful energy and strong connection to Jamaica’s sound system culture. While many riddims in 2011 used digital beats, Thirteen Riddim mixed live horn riffs with sharp drum patterns, giving it a classic feel and a lively modern twist. 10 FLOOR RECORDS, the producer behind this riddim, is known for creative work in the dancehall scene. The label built a reputation for bringing new sounds and artists together. Their attention to detail and rich production style helped Thirteen Riddim shine. Artists on this riddim brought their own style. Don Tippa delivered two standout tracks, “Bad Mind Inna Real Life” and “Gal Dweet.” Don Tippa is well known for his energetic delivery and for working with top producers in the UK reggae scene. Eska’s “Pagans” added a deep, conscious message. Note’s “When I Rise” brought uplifting vibes. Jq’s “Haberdashery Beauty Queen” and Klarriti’s “From Wha Day” showed the riddim’s range, from playful to serious. Compared to other mixes from its era, the Thirteen Riddim sound system cut was more raw and dancefloor-focused, making it a favorite for DJs and fans. The teamwork of artists and 10 FLOOR RECORDS made this release a lasting dancehall classic.
Thirteen Tracklist:
- Don Tippa – Bad Mind Inna Real Life
- Don Tippa – Gal Dweet
- Eska – Pagans
- Note – When I Rise
- Jq – Haberdashery Beauty Queen
- Klarriti – From Wha Day
- Ice – I And I Real
- Ice – No Fly Cant Pitch
- Sugga Banton – Inna Mi Dinner
- Teacha Dee – Everywhere
- Teacha Dee – Mr. Thirteen
- Tee Jay – Girls From All Around
